Types of Home Running Machines

There are a number of kinds of crowning achievement machines available in the market today. Below is a comparative table highlighting the functions of some popular types:

Type of TreadmillMotorizedManualFoldingSlope Trainer
DescriptionDeals different speeds; ideal for running and interval training.Requires user to set the pace; excellent for walking and light jogging.Space-saving style; can be easily saved away.Consists of adjustable slope for added strength.
Key FeaturesPre-programmed workouts, heart rate monitors.Easy mechanics, requires no power.Compact design, easy to move and store.Steeper incline for enhanced calorie burn.
Suitable ForSerious runners, those looking for diverse exercises.Beginners, those concentrated on light cardio.Minimal space property owners.Users desiring high-intensity exercises.
Price Range₤ 300 - ₤ 3,000+₤ 100 - ₤ 500₤ 200 - ₤ 2,000₤ 600 - ₤ 2,500

Maintenance Tips for Home Running Machines

To ensure longevity and optimal efficiency of a crowning achievement machine, think about these upkeep pointers:

Regular Cleaning:

  • Wipe down the belt and frame after each use to prevent dust accumulation.

Lubrication:

  • Periodically lube the running belt to lower friction and wear.

Inspect Components:

  • Regularly look for loose bolts and torn cords.

Software Updates:

  • If relevant, keep the machine's software application up to date for optimal performance.

Expert Servicing:

  • Consider having the machine serviced by an expert annually.

Q2: How much area do I need for a treadmill?A2: The area needed will depend on the design. Typically, you must designate a space of at least 6 feet by 3 feet, plus additional space for entry and exit.

Q3: Can a crowning achievement machine assist with weight reduction?A3: Yes, when combined with a balanced diet plan, utilizing a treadmill regularly can aid in burning calories and attaining weight reduction goals.

Q4: How often should I oil my treadmill?A4: Depending on usage, it's generally advisable to oil the running belt when every 3-6 months.

Q5: What includes should I try to find in a treadmill for running?A5: Look for features such as a powerful motor (minimum 2.5 HP), incline settings, sturdiness, and consumer assistance.
